Navigating Therapy with ADHD and PMDD: What You Need to Know

If you’re in therapy for ADHD and PMDD, you’ve likely noticed that these two conditions can sometimes feel like they’re teaming up against you. ADHD (Attention-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der) and PMDD (Premenstrual Dysphoric Disorder) each bring their own challenges, but when combined, they can make everyday life feel particularly overwhelming.
